Overview:

Elevate your event safety planning and decision making by joining this dynamic, interactive seminar!  We will highlight the essential elements of an outdoor event hazardous weather safety plan and take a hands-on approach to incorporating tools and support services available from the National Weather Service into decision making.  Building on the successful 2025 format, this year’s program features all-new interactive scenarios.  Take part in breakout groups, collaborating directly with NWS staff to apply concepts to real-world situations, followed by large-group discussions and sharing of ideas and best practices.  Seminar objectives include:

  • Demonstrate awareness of NWS products and services available before and during special events
  • Understand the importance of having an event weather safety plan and the importance of calculating the time needed to alert and evacuate/shelter the attendees
  • Understand the importance of having a designated weather liaison for the event to support planning and decision making
  • Demonstrate awareness and knowledge of NWS products, services and Event Ready tools to make informed decisions regarding the execution of evacuation/shelter plans
